There are times when we feel like we are sitting on the side of the road while the world passes us by. We may feel discouraged, disillusioned, and ready to quit. But Jesus is ready to offer an opportunity if we put our trust in him. In this study we will look at how Jesus took Bartimaeus from being a blind beggar sitting on the side of the road, to a person who was following Jesus on the road. Jesus wants to do the same for us. Whatever is keeping us sitting on the side of the road, Jesus can heal if we put the problem in his hands and trust in him. This study looks at five steps we need to take if we want Jesus to get a new START.
